Candidates preparing for TANCET English section can refer to Objective General English by S. P. Bakshi, English Grammar and Composition by SC Gupta, Word Power Made Easy by Norman Lewis, among others. Candidates can seek help from previous year's toppers to know more about the study material.

Yes, CAT books can help while preparing for the TANCET MBA exam. CAT is a national level MBA exam, whereas TANCET is a state level MBA exam. Several topics in both exams are common. Therefore, CAT books can be a good resource for preparing for the TANCET exam.

Best time to start TANCET preparation is 4-5 months before exam date. Candidates who have studied for any MBA exam before might only need 1-2 months of preparation.

TANCET exam is conducted once every year. Candidates can appear for the TANCET exam once within one academic year. For admission to the next year, candidates have to appear for the subsequent term of the TANCET exam. However, the exam schedule and frequency might change in the future.
